Capacity note — Lunaris Orders

Welcome aboard. Soft deletes in the orders table mean rows are flagged, not removed, so the table grows roughly 4% per month even when order volume is flat. The nightly compactor on Vendelhurst's batch tier reclaims space once tombstones pass a threshold. If compaction lags, index bloat slows the picker queries first. The thresholds and batch sizes below are what we currently run in production.

tuning table, yajog-yahof:
BUDGETS = {
    "lamvan": 303,
    "wenox": 460,
    "fenvan": 525,
}

Plugin authors integrating with the Merrowdeck deduplication engine must respect per-tenant quotas. Each dedupe pass scores candidate customer records in batches, and batch sizing is enforced server-side; requests exceeding the limits are rejected, not truncated. Fuzzy-match calls count double against the quota. Hard limits are reviewed quarterly by the Merrowdeck platform team. The current enforced values are listed below.

constants for bagag-fawip:
BUDGETS = {
    "wenius": 400,
    "brieth": 224,
    "rusath": 783,
    "eliys": 187,
    "aldax": 737,
    "ralion": 818,
    "istius": 153,
}

As release manager, you should use the shared release service account rather than a personal token, since the nightly graph snapshots run unattended. The token is read-only and scoped to metadata queries; it cannot publish or delete artifacts. Rotation happens automatically every sixty days, and the pipeline picks up the new value from the secrets store. For manual runs, use the current key below.

API key for yahig-tadup: kto7_ubizbYm

**Onboarding: shipping flags with Togglewright**

New folks: all rollouts go through Togglewright. Define the flag in the registry, set cohorts (internal → 5% → 50% → GA), and attach a kill switch. Flag configs are pulled by the edge fleet every 60s, so changes land fast — double-check targeting before saving. Configs must be signed before the fleet will accept them; unsigned pushes are silently dropped. Sign each config with the key below.

deploy key for kajof-fajop: bky6_gDHw9Q